Do a pen or pencil drawing of an inorganic object and one of an organic object without looking at the groundsheet. If the temptation to look is too great, put a sheet of cardboard or paper over the groundsheet so that you cannot see your drawing. Try drawing the object several times, then choose the best one from each of the two categories: organic and inorganic objects.
Your initial response to this assignment will be "I cant do this." Your abilities will surprise you once you get into the "groove". The purpose of this assignment is to create strictly from the left brain, drawing what you see and not what you know. If you concentrate on your subject hard enough, you will be amazed at the results: sheer, unmolested creativity in action. It will also boost your confidence in your intuitive ability to create. Final dimensions and media are up to you.
The purpose of this assignment is for you to begin to develop your drawing skills using line. In order to be an effective and accurate draftsman, you will need to carefully observe and scrutinize your subject. You will need to base your drawings mostly on your visual input alone; you must draw what you see, not what you know. This exercise will awaken these areas of the brain and enable you to become a better designer.
